Anodic Half-Reaction (Iron Dissolution)

The oxidation half-reaction at the anode where iron atoms leave the lattice, lose electrons, and enter solution as ions. This is where metal is lost and where pits begin. Anodic inhibitors such as nitrite work by preventing this departure.
